If I am using something that utilizes vaapi, like VLC for instance, the screen only refreshes on mouse movements. This becomes abundantly clear when I watch the clock on my panel for example, which displays seconds on it. It will sit at the same time and not tick the seconds if I leave the mouse perfectly still. As soon as I move the mouse the clock updates and will continue to update as long as I keep the mouse moving. I am sure you will want more information but I am not sure what to gather. I am using the 3.18.7-200.fc21.x86_64 kernel. Just let me know what other information you need and I will be happy to provide it.
